What Documents Are Required for Meydan Company Registration?

The required documents can vary slightly depending on the business structure (individual vs. corporate shareholder), and whether you are applying for a visa. Below is a categorized breakdown of the mandatory and optional documents.


1. Passport Copy

Mandatory for all individual shareholders and managers.

Your passport must be:

  • Valid for at least 6 months

  • Clearly scanned, in color

  • Showing full details including signature and photo page

Tip: Ensure your name matches any other documents exactly (including middle names or initials).


2. Passport-Sized Photo (Digital)

Mandatory for individual shareholders and managers.

Photo requirements:

  • White background

  • JPEG or PNG format

  • High resolution

  • Recently taken (within 6 months)

This photo is used for your Emirates ID (if applying for a visa) and company license records.


3. UAE Entry Stamp or Visa Page (if applicable)

Required if you are in the UAE during the application process.

If you’re currently inside the country, Meydan Free Zone may ask for:

  • UAE entry stamp

  • Valid visit visa

  • Emirates ID (if already a resident)

If you’re applying from outside the UAE, this is not required initially.


4. Proof of Residential Address

Sometimes requested to verify the shareholder’s or manager’s current location.

Accepted documents include:

  • Utility bill (not older than 3 months)

  • Tenancy contract

  • Bank statement with address

  • Driver’s license (with address visible)

This requirement is more common if you’re setting up from abroad and not yet a UAE resident.

Additional Documents for Specific Scenarios

Now that we've covered the basics, here are some conditional documents that may apply in certain cases:


7. No Objection Certificate (NOC) – If UAE Resident on Employment Visa

If you are currently under a UAE employment visa and want to open a company in Meydan, you may need a No Objection Certificate (NOC) from your current employer.

This is not always required, especially if:

  • You're opening a company as an investor, not as an employee

  • You're not applying for a visa immediately

Check with Meydan or your setup agent.


8. Corporate Shareholder Documents – If Company Is the Owner

If another company (local or foreign) is registering the Meydan entity, you will need:

  • Certificate of Incorporation

  • Memorandum & Articles of Association

  • Board Resolution to establish the new entity

  • Certificate of Incumbency or good standing (for foreign companies)

  • Passport copy of the authorized signatory

All documents must be notarized and attested, especially if issued outside the UAE.


9. Business Plan – Sometimes Requested

Not always mandatory, but Meydan Free Zone may request a simple business plan, especially for:

  • Unusual business activities

  • Financial services

  • High-risk or regulated industries

The business plan typically includes:

  • Overview of services/products

  • Target market and customer segment

  • Revenue projections

  • Founders’ background and experience


10. Power of Attorney (If Using a Representative)

If someone else is applying on your behalf (like a consultant or partner), you may need to sign a Power of Attorney (PoA) authorizing them to act for you.

This document is required only in cases where you're not present or not signing documents yourself.


What’s Not Required (Surprisingly)

  • Bank statements are not typically needed for initial registration

  • Proof of share capital is not required — Meydan has no minimum capital

  • Office lease agreement is not needed unless you're applying for visas and need physical office space (virtual offices are allowed)

How Long Does Meydan Company Registration Take?

Once all documents are submitted correctly:

  • Initial approval: Within 24 to 48 hours

  • License issuance: 3–5 working days

  • Visa processing (if needed): 7–10 working days after license

Meydan Free Zone is known for being among the fastest in Dubai when it comes to processing.

FAQs

1. Do I need to be in the UAE to register a company in Meydan Free Zone?
No, you can complete the entire process remotely, including document submission and e-signatures. However, visa stamping and Emirates ID (if applying for a visa) require in-person visits later.

2. Is a UAE residency visa mandatory for Meydan company formation?
No. You can register a company without applying for a visa. Visa is optional and can be added later.

3. Can I register a Meydan company with multiple shareholders?
Yes, Meydan Free Zone allows single or multiple shareholders. Each must provide passport and personal documents as part of the application.
